~ubuntu-branches/ubuntu/oneiric/postgresql-9.1/oneiric-security

« back to all changes in this revision

Viewing changes to src/tools/msvc/clean.bat

  • Committer: Bazaar Package Importer
  • Author(s): Martin Pitt
  • Date: 2011-05-11 10:41:53 UTC
  • Revision ID: james.westby@ubuntu.com-20110511104153-psbh2o58553fv1m0
Tags: upstream-9.1~beta1
ImportĀ upstreamĀ versionĀ 9.1~beta1

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
@echo off
 
2
REM src/tools/msvc/clean.bat
 
3
 
 
4
set DIST=0
 
5
if "%1"=="dist" set DIST=1
 
6
 
 
7
set D=%CD%
 
8
if exist ..\msvc if exist ..\..\..\src cd ..\..\..
 
9
 
 
10
if exist debug rd /s /q debug
 
11
if exist release rd /s /q release
 
12
for %%f in (*.vcproj) do del %%f
 
13
if exist pgsql.sln del /q pgsql.sln
 
14
if exist pgsql.sln.cache del /q pgsql.sln.cache
 
15
del /s /q src\bin\win32ver.rc 2> NUL
 
16
del /s /q src\interfaces\win32ver.rc 2> NUL
 
17
if exist src\backend\win32ver.rc del /q src\backend\win32ver.rc
 
18
 
 
19
REM Delete files created with GenerateFiles() in Solution.pm
 
20
if exist src\include\pg_config.h del /q src\include\pg_config.h
 
21
if exist src\include\pg_config_os.h del /q src\include\pg_config_os.h
 
22
if %DIST%==1 if exist src\backend\parser\gram.h del /q src\backend\parser\gram.h
 
23
if exist src\include\utils\errcodes.h del /q src\include\utils\errcodes.h
 
24
if exist src\include\utils\fmgroids.h del /q src\include\utils\fmgroids.h
 
25
if exist src\include\utils\probes.h del /q src\include\utils\probes.h
 
26
 
 
27
if %DIST%==1 if exist src\backend\utils\fmgroids.h del /q src\backend\utils\fmgroids.h
 
28
if %DIST%==1 if exist src\backend\utils\fmgrtab.c del /q src\backend\utils\fmgrtab.c
 
29
if %DIST%==1 if exist src\backend\catalog\postgres.bki del /q src\backend\catalog\postgres.bki
 
30
if %DIST%==1 if exist src\backend\catalog\postgres.description del /q src\backend\catalog\postgres.description
 
31
if %DIST%==1 if exist src\backend\catalog\postgres.shdescription del /q src\backend\catalog\postgres.shdescription
 
32
if %DIST%==1 if exist src\backend\catalog\schemapg.h del /q src\backend\catalog\schemapg.h
 
33
if %DIST%==1 if exist src\backend\parser\scan.c del /q src\backend\parser\scan.c
 
34
if %DIST%==1 if exist src\backend\parser\gram.c del /q src\backend\parser\gram.c
 
35
if %DIST%==1 if exist src\backend\bootstrap\bootscanner.c del /q src\backend\bootstrap\bootscanner.c
 
36
if %DIST%==1 if exist src\backend\bootstrap\bootparse.c del /q src\backend\bootstrap\bootparse.c
 
37
if %DIST%==1 if exist src\backend\utils\misc\guc-file.c del /q src\backend\utils\misc\guc-file.c
 
38
 
 
39
 
 
40
if exist src\bin\psql\sql_help.h del /q src\bin\psql\sql_help.h
 
41
 
 
42
if exist src\interfaces\libpq\libpq.rc del /q src\interfaces\libpq\libpq.rc
 
43
if exist src\interfaces\libpq\libpqdll.def del /q src\interfaces\libpq\libpqdll.def
 
44
if exist src\interfaces\ecpg\compatlib\compatlib.def del /q src\interfaces\ecpg\compatlib\compatlib.def
 
45
if exist src\interfaces\ecpg\ecpglib\ecpglib.def del /q src\interfaces\ecpg\ecpglib\ecpglib.def
 
46
if exist src\interfaces\ecpg\include\ecpg_config.h del /q src\interfaces\ecpg\include\ecpg_config.h
 
47
if exist src\interfaces\ecpg\pgtypeslib\pgtypeslib.def del /q src\interfaces\ecpg\pgtypeslib\pgtypeslib.def
 
48
if %DIST%==1 if exist src\interfaces\ecpg\preproc\pgc.c del /q src\interfaces\ecpg\preproc\pgc.c
 
49
if %DIST%==1 if exist src\interfaces\ecpg\preproc\preproc.c del /q src\interfaces\ecpg\preproc\preproc.c
 
50
if %DIST%==1 if exist src\interfaces\ecpg\preproc\preproc.h del /q src\interfaces\ecpg\preproc\preproc.h
 
51
 
 
52
if exist src\port\pg_config_paths.h del /q src\port\pg_config_paths.h
 
53
 
 
54
if exist src\pl\plperl\spi.c del /q src\pl\plperl\spi.c
 
55
if %DIST%==1 if exist src\pl\plpgsql\src\pl_gram.c del /q src\pl\plpgsql\src\pl_gram.c
 
56
if %DIST%==1 if exist src\pl\plpgsql\src\pl_gram.h del /q src\pl\plpgsql\src\pl_gram.h
 
57
 
 
58
if %DIST%==1 if exist src\bin\psql\psqlscan.c del /q src\bin\psql\psqlscan.c
 
59
 
 
60
if %DIST%==1 if exist contrib\cube\cubescan.c del /q contrib\cube\cubescan.c
 
61
if %DIST%==1 if exist contrib\cube\cubeparse.c del /q contrib\cube\cubeparse.c
 
62
if %DIST%==1 if exist contrib\seg\segscan.c del /q contrib\seg\segscan.c
 
63
if %DIST%==1 if exist contrib\seg\segparse.c del /q contrib\seg\segparse.c
 
64
 
 
65
if exist src\test\regress\tmp_check rd /s /q src\test\regress\tmp_check
 
66
if exist contrib\spi\refint.dll del /q contrib\spi\refint.dll
 
67
if exist contrib\spi\autoinc.dll del /q contrib\spi\autoinc.dll
 
68
if exist src\test\regress\regress.dll del /q src\test\regress\regress.dll
 
69
if exist src\test\regress\refint.dll del /q src\test\regress\refint.dll
 
70
if exist src\test\regress\autoinc.dll del /q src\test\regress\autoinc.dll
 
71
 
 
72
REM Clean up datafiles built with contrib
 
73
REM cd contrib
 
74
REM for /r %%f in (*.sql) do if exist %%f.in del %%f
 
75
 
 
76
cd %D%
 
77
 
 
78
REM Clean up ecpg regression test files
 
79
msbuild /NoLogo ecpg_regression.proj /t:clean /v:q
 
80
 
 
81
goto :eof